SOS MS monitoring system and KJ216 mine pressure and stress monitoring system were used to monitor the mine earthquake activities of Yangliu Coal Mine , mine pressure and stress, which effectively forecast the state migration of the igneous rock for and the dynamic impact propensity of the working face, and provide a powerful guarantee for 1061 safety mining in working face.关键词
